Seattle Study Club

The Seattle Study Club is a network of doctors that are invested in furthering their knowledge to provide excellent care to each and every patient that comes through their doors. Seattle Study Club is known for having over 260 clubs in the United States , Canada, England, Scotland, Northern Ireland, Republic of Ireland, Germany, Italy, Spain, India, China, Japan, Australia, New Zealand, and Trinidad, and Tobago.

Each club meets regularly for interactive educational programs, discussions on the latest developments in dentistry and presentations by world-renowned clinical speakers. These meetings assist in providing a forum for each member to discuss ans plan cases with the collective knowledge  of the entire group and more.
